Educated by Tara Westover

35133922Tara Westover was seventeen when she first stepped foot into a classroom.  She grew up in Idaho with a Mormon survivalist family.  Her dad had very strong non government views and thought the end of the world was coming.  He also thought the family should not interact with medical or educational systems.  Tara’s story contains many horrific accounts of medical issues going untreated.   Tara’s mother worked as a midwife and herbalist.  She concocted various remedies to cure her families’ ailments and injuries.  Tara worked for both of her parents and spent many hours working with her father under horrific conditions in his salvage yard, as well as helping her mother with her business by concocted herbal remedies.  Tara also dealt with abuse and violence from her brother.  Tara eventually decided that the only way to leave her dysfunctional family was to go to college like her brother Tyler.  Thus, she began teaching herself to prepare for the ACT and scored high enough to get accepted to BYU.  She went onto Harvard and Cambridge University, and earned her PhD in history.

This book is such an inspirational read and shows one that anything is possible if one sets their mind to it.
